Fire Emblem Heroes is, according to Polygon, going to come out tomorrow. That’s right, mark your calendars. Or don’t bother, because it’s coming out tomorrow and it’s pretty much nearly tomorrow already.

We’ve also got some more details about what the game is going to be like. And apparently it’s a departure from the model that Nintendo used with Super Mario Run. Because Fire Emblem Heroes is free to play. With that in mind, here’s everything we know about the game.

It’s free to play

And by the sounds of things it’s free to play in a traditionally mobile sort of way. You’re not going to get a chunk of the game and then have to pay for the rest. Instead it’s wait-timers, currencies, and all of that stuff.

There’s a lot of RPG goodness here

While it might be free to play, there’s going to be a lot here that Fire Emblem fans are going to be familiar with. There’s characters to level up, a massive world to explore, and lots and lots of battles to engage in.

It looks cool

There’s definitely a level of polish here that you’d expect from a Nintendo game. There are a variety of different art styles, and they all look slick and lovely. Plus the interface looks pretty solid as well.

There’s a lot to do

It might be free to play, but that doesn’t mean that there’s a shallowness to the experience. There are still plenty of options with every move you make, and a level of strategy that other mobile games might be lacking.
